European Film Agencies Attend EFARN’s 15th Annual Meeting in Berlin

Nevafilm Research Company represented Russia at the 15th meeting of the European Film Agency Research Network (EFARN) which took place in Berlin’s film museum.

 

“Deutsche Kinemathek” in October 2017. The meeting hosted by the German Federal Film Board revolved around issues associated with the digital disruption of the European film industry. Among other things, EFARN members discussed the changing nature of media consumption, the increasing popularity of online streaming services with younger audiences, as well as the redefined gender roles in the quickly changing film industry.

 

Nevafilm Research Senior Analyst Xenia Leontyeva gave a talk on the exhibition fee bill drafted by the Russian Ministry of Culture in August. If implemented, the bill would increase the exhibition fee from 3500 rubles ($60) to five million rubles ($84000). Leontyeva walked the meeting participants through the specifics of the proposed measure and presented the findings of a Nevafilm Research study evaluating its potential consequences.
